CI note: LargeLens diff viewer — flaky render tests

New folks: if the LargeLens large-file diff suite fails on the `chunked-render` stage, it's almost always the shared fixture cache, not your change. The 2 GB sample file gets truncated when the cache node evicts mid-download. Fix: clear the fixture cache and rerun; don't retry blindly more than twice. If the failure persists with a full fixture, it's real — file a ticket with the stage log attached. Match your run against the trace token below.

trace token, fafog-kageg: htk4_98e6

## Tuning

Fan-out in Quillcast is bounded by a token bucket per subscriber shard plus a global dispatch ceiling. When the ceiling is reached, producers block rather than drop, so misconfigured limits show up as publish latency, not lost notifications. Reviewers should check that any change keeps the shard limits strictly below the global one. The active constants appear below.

tuning table, yajog-yahof:
BUDGETS = {
    "lamvan": 303,
    "wenox": 460,
    "fenvan": 525,
}

# Break-Glass: Catalog Cache Invalidation

Scope: the Pinrow product catalog at Veldstone Retail. If stale prices persist after a purge and the Hollowmere invalidation queue is wedged, use break-glass to flush the edge tier directly. Contractors: get verbal sign-off from the catalog lead first. Steps: open the Hollowmere admin shell, select emergency-flush, confirm the tenant, and run it once — repeated flushes thrash the origin. Access is logged and expires after 20 minutes. Unseal the admin shell with the passphrase below.

recovery phrase for kahop-tajog: istix-casvan

Management Meeting Minutes — Harwick & Sloane Ltd.

Attendees: R. Marsh, T. Obel, F. Lindqvist. Agenda: FY-next training budget.

Decisions: Training budget set at 2.1% of payroll, up from 1.6%. Priority: certification for the Ashvale service unit. External vendors capped at 40% of spend; remainder delivered in-house. Quarterly utilization reporting to the board. Unspent funds do not roll over. Motion carried unanimously. Minutes approved for board circulation. A confidential planning note for directors follows immediately below.

internal memo for kawip-hadug: Headcount on the Wenwyn team goes from 7 to 140 by the end of January. Gross margin on Wenwyn came in at 20 percent against a plan of 15 percent.